Product reviews:
Nicholas
2026-03-03 iphone Xs
Peppa Pig 21017S Magna Doodle - Buy peppa magna doodle
peppa magna doodle
Tom
2026-02-27 iphone 6s Plus
BN Peppa Pig Doodle Board on Carousell peppa magna doodle
peppa magna doodle
Maxwell
2026-03-04 iphone SE
Cra-Z-Art Peppa Pig Travel Magna Doodle peppa magna doodle
peppa magna doodle
Peppa Pig ABC Magna Doodle Harvey peppa magna doodle
peppa magna doodle